diff --git a/docs/Messaging/_index.md b/docs/Messaging/_index.md deleted file mode 100644 index 5344a178..00000000 --- a/docs/Messaging/_index.md +++ /dev/null @@ -1,23 +0,0 @@ ---- -title: "Messaging" -weight: 100 ---- - -## Headers - -- `message.h` - Defines the core message model. etl::imessage is the base interface (virtual or non-virtual, depending on `ETL_HAS_VIRTUAL_MESSAGES`). `etl::message` provides typed messages with static IDs. Type traits (`is_message`, `is_message_type`, etc.) and ID comparison utilities support compile-time validation. -- `message_router.h` - Defines `etl::imessage_router`, the central routing interface with receive, accepts, and router identity. Provides message_router that statically dispatches by message ID (contiguous IDs optimized). Includes null_message_router and message_producer helpers, plus send_message utilities. -- `message_bus.h` -Implements `etl::imessage_bus`, a router that manages a sorted list of subscribed routers and forwards messages based on destination ID (broadcast or addressed). Supports subscription limits and forwards to successors. -- `message_broker.h` - Implements etl::message_broker, a router with explicit subscription objects mapping routers to message ID lists (span). It routes only to subscribers that match both message ID and destination ID, then forwards to any successor. -- `message_packet.h` - A type-erased, in-place container for a fixed set of message types. Validates message ID acceptance, supports copy/move, and exposes `get()` as `etl::imessage&`. Uses aligned storage sized to the largest message type. -- `shared_message.h` - Reference-counted wrapper around pooled messages (`ireference_counted_message_pool`). The message_broker is similar to the message_bus, but it provides more control over the routing of messages. While the message_bus simply broadcasts every message to all subscribers, the message_broker allows you to specify which subscribers should receive each message. - -Derived from `imessage_router`. - -## Types - -```cpp -message_id_span_t etl::span -``` - -## subscription -A nested class of `etl::message_broker`. -The base for broker subscription information. -Derive from this to define your subscription class. -See Example. - ---- - -```cpp -subscription(etl::imessage_router& router) -``` -Constructor. - ---- - -```cpp -virtual message_id_span_t message_id_list() const = 0; -``` -Override this to return a span of message ids. - -## message_broker - -```cpp -message_broker() -``` -The broker is constructed with an id of `etl::imessage_router::MESSAGE_BROKER`. - ---- - -```cpp -message_broker(etl::imessage_router& successor) -``` -The broker is constructed with an id of `etl::imessage_router::MESSAGE_BROKER`. -Sets the successor. - ---- - -```cpp -message_broker(etl::message_router_id_t id) -``` -The broker is constructed with the specified id. - ---- - -```cpp -message_broker(etl::message_router_id_t id, etl::imessage_router& successor) -``` -The broker is constructed with the specified id. -Sets the successor. - ---- - -```cpp -void subscribe(etl::imessage_router& router) -``` -Subscribes an `etl::imessage_router` derived class to the broker. -A subscription object must have a lifetime of at least the same as the broker. -A subscription cannot be shared with another broker. - ---- - -```cpp -void unsubscribe(etl::imessage_router& router) -``` -Unsubscribes the specified `etl::imessage_router` derived class from the bus. -Does not unsubscribe from nested buses. - ---- - -```cpp -void receive(const etl::imessage& message) -void receive(etl::shared_message message) -``` -Receives a message and distributes it to all subscribers that have registered to receive the message type. -Forwards the message to any successor. - -Override this in a derived class if you wish to capture messages sent to the broker. -Call the base receive function from here to allow normal operation to continue. - ---- - -```cpp -bool accepts(etl::message_id_t id) const -``` -Always returns `true`. - ---- - -```cpp -void clear() -``` -Clears the broker of all subscribers. - ---- - -```cpp -ETL_DEPRECATED bool is_null_router() const ETL_OVERRIDE -``` -Always returns `false`. - ---- - -```cpp -bool is_producer() const ETL_OVERRIDE -``` -Always returns `true`. - ---- - -```cpp -bool is_consumer() const ETL_OVERRIDE -``` -Always returns `true`. - ---- - -```cpp -bool empty() const -``` -Returns `true` is the are are no subscribers. - -## Example -```cpp -// Some router ids. -enum -{ - ROUTER_ID_1, - ROUTER_ID_2, -}; - -// Custom subscription type. -class Subscription : public etl::message_broker::subscription -{ -public: - - Subscription(etl::imessage_router& router, std::initializer_list id_list_) - : etl::message_broker::subscription(router) - , id_list(id_list_) - { - } - - etl::message_broker::message_id_span_t message_id_list() const override - { - return etl::message_broker::message_id_span_t(id_list.begin(), id_list.end()); - } - - std::vector id_list; -}; - -// Instances of messages. -Message1 message1; -Message2 message2; -Message3 message3; -Message4 message4; - -// Custom broker. -class Broker : public etl::message_broker -{ -public: - - using etl::message_broker::receive; - - // Hook incoming messages and translate Message4 to Message3. - void receive(const etl::imessage& msg) override - { - if (msg.get_message_id() == Message4::ID) - { - etl::message_broker::receive(Message3()); - } - else - { - etl::message_broker::receive(msg); - } - } -}; - -// Instances of message routers. -Router1 router1; -Router2 router2; - -// The subscriptions. -Subscription subscription1{ router1, { Message1::ID, Message2::ID } }; -Subscription subscription2{ router2, { Message2::ID, Message3::ID } }; - -// Instance of message broker. -etl::message_broker broker; - -// Subscribe router1 and router1 to the broker. -broker.subscribe(subscription1); -broker.subscribe(subscription2); - -broker.receive(message1); // Received by router1 -broker.receive(message2); // Received by router1 and router2 -broker.receive(message3); // Received by router2 -broker.receive(message4); // Received by router2 as a Message3 -``` diff --git a/docs/Messaging/message-bus.md b/docs/Messaging/message-bus.md deleted file mode 100644 index 921e5b86..00000000 --- a/docs/Messaging/message-bus.md +++ /dev/null @@ -1,207 +0,0 @@ ---- -title: "message_bus" -weight: 5 ---- - -{{< callout type="info">}} - Header: `message_broker.h` - From: `20.33.0` -{{< /callout >}} - -Message Bus - -This page documents version `20.0.0` and above. - -A variant of the observer pattern in that message routers and derived types are be able to subscribe to messages on a bus. The messages can be either broadcast, to be automatically picked up by any router that has a handler, or addressed to a particular router or router id. Message buses may be nested by setting a successor. - -## imessage_bus -Derived from imessage_router. - -The base for all message buses. -Inherits publicly from `etl::imessage_router`. -Message buses are therefore also a type of router. -Objects of type `etl::imessage_bus` cannot be directly constructed. - -## Member functions - -```cpp -bool subscribe(etl::imessage_router& router) -``` -Subscribes an `etl::imessage_router` derived class to the bus. -Returns `true` on success. - ---- - -```cpp -void unsubscribe(etl::imessage_router& router) -``` -Unsubscribes the specified `etl::imessage_router` derived class from the bus. -Does not unsubscribe from nested buses. - ---- - -```cpp -void unsubscribe(etl::message_router_id_t id) -``` -Unsubscribes routers with the specified id from the bus. -Does not unsubscribe from nested buses. - -`etl::imessage::MESSAGE_BUS` will unsubscribe all message buses. -`etl::imessage::ALL_MESSAGE_ROUTERS` will unsubscribe all routers and buses.
